Spend 6 nights 7 days exploring Kenya’s wilderness, Samburu National Reserve, Masai Mara National Reserve, Aberdares National Park, Lake Nakuru National Park. This safari begins with Samburu National Reserve a true wilderness and home to unique wildlife and plant life and onward continuation to The Aberdare National Park, an isolated range that forms the eastern wall of the rift valley and diverse topography with amazing views of wildlife night game viewing.

Itinerary

Day 1Nairobi -Maasai Mara

Arrival
You’ll be collected from the airport.
Accommodation before the tour starts can be arranged for an extra cost.

Met by our representative Seven By far representative, at the international airport briefed, and drive through the floor of the Rift Valley to the world famous game reserve, the Masai Mara arriving at Mara sekenani camp in time for lunch. At 1600hrs enjoy an afternoon game drive in the reserve. Dinner and overnight at the Mara Sekenani camp.

Day 2Maasai Mara

Full day in the reserve with both morning and afternoon game drives at 0630hrs and 1600hrs respectively. The Mara is the northern extension of the Serengeti and its rolling plains are home to hundreds of plains game together with predators that feed on them. All meals and overnight at Mara Sekenani Camp.

Day 3Masai Mara - Lake Nakuru

After breakfast, drive to Lake Nakuru, to arrive at the Lake Nakuru Lodge in time for Lunch, relax and have an afternoon siesta and later at 1600hrs enjoy and after noon game drive that takes to the lake right in bird-life and animals, Dinner & overnight at the Lake Nakuru Lodge.

Day 4Lake Nakuru –Samburu

Depart early in the morning, after breakfast, with stop over the Equator Point, drive north through the lush Kikuyu farmlands and coffee plantation to the cool Kenyan highlands to arrive at the Samburu sopaLodge in time for lunch. At 1600hrs, enjoy an afternoon game drive within the park to introduce you to the game in the area. Dinner and overnight at the Samburu Sopa.

Day 5Samburu

Full day spent in Samburu with early morning and afternoon game drives in Samburu Game Reserve, which covers 40 square miles (104 square kilometers). This is the homeland of the nomadic Samburu people, whose culture attaches great value to tending their livestock of cattle, sheep, goats and camels as their main economic activity. Samburu is rich in species not seen in southern Kenya’s more famous parks. You’ll also have a good chance at spotting lions, cheetahs and the elusive leopard. The semiarid landscape is dramatic, with the rugged outcrop known as Mt. Ololokwe a prominent feature. The Ewaso Ngiro River, which forms the southern boundary of the reserve, attracts many birds and is a popular watering hole for elephants. Arrive at your lodge in time for lunch and some relaxation, and then take an evening drive for more game viewing. Meals and overnight at your Lodge.

Day 6Samburu -Aberdare

Depart after breakfast and proceed south to the Aberdare Country Club. The Club is the base hotel for the tree hotel Ark. Lunch at Aberdare Country Club and at 1430hrs, transfer to the Ark, which is located in the Aberdare National Park, with small overnight bags as most of the luggage is left at the club. The Ark has various decks and balconies for easy viewing and photography of wild game.
Dinner and overnight of game viewing at the lodge.

Day 7Aberdare -Nairobi

Breakfast and return to Nairobi. Lunch at the famous Carnivore restaurant, justifiably referred to as Africa’s Greatest Eating Experience, having twice been voted amongst the world’s 50 best restaurants by UK based Restaurant magazine. Drop off at the Jomo Kenyatta International Airport for your flight back home. Great Holiday Ends.
